Getting back to your example, I have some questions.  Are all of those
paths relative to the LDRAWDIR?  Do you allow absolute paths?  Is the
directory containing the model file allowed to be moved around in the
SCAN order?  How would you specify that?

Yes the paths are relative, absolute paths are not forseen at the moment,
but it wouldn't be a big deal to make them absolute or to even mix them.
You can move any of the directories arround however you like, and I must
ommit I didn't think about the current model directory. It would be possible
to add this feature in as e.g. SHOW [PROJECT-DIR] where the thing would be a
keyword. The problem is just that this path is known only after the
model has been saved once, if you save it under another name in a different
location it would change, and not find anything there anymore.

My approach here was to say that sub-models of a project shouldn't have any
official names anyway, but if there is one than I would assume that it would
be
an unofficial part, to be replaced by a official part once available. The
project path itself is currently the last one in the search.
